Patch 3.3 PTR: New weekly quests to do while raiding

At this point in the PTR, we're told that the quests reward 10 Emblems of Frost (which again hints that they'll be broken up over weekly periods rather than daily periods, as 10 Emblems a day is a heck of a lot of emblems). But of course that can all change before the actual patch goes live. Just know that if these quests go in, a) your raid will probably be heading back to farmed content at least once per week, and b) at least you'll be getting a nice reward from the run.
- Lord Marrowgar Must Die! (Icecrown Raid)
- Lord Jaraxxus Must Die!
- XT-002 Deconstructor Must Die!
- Ignis the Furnace Master Must Die!
- Razorscale Must Die!
- Flame Leviathan Must Die!
- Malygos Must Die!
- Patchwerk Must Die!
- Instructor Razuvious Must Die!
- Noth the Plaguebringer Must Die!
- Anub'Rekhan Must Die!
- Sartharion Must Die!
